The New Balance FuelCell 996 v5 is a tennis shoe designed for players seeking a balance of comfort and stability. Its construction features a notable **12 mm drop**, making it ideal for athletes who prioritize agility during rapid movements on the court.

Lab tests indicate that the lightweight design, combined with the firm 31.5 HA foam, translates to a stable platform that supports quick directional changes. This combination ensures optimal performance for competitive players looking to maintain speed without sacrificing support.

Key Features

  • FuelCell foam delivers a propulsive feel to help drive you forward.
  • NDurance rubber outsole technology provides superior durability in high-wear areas.
  • Constructed from synthetic/mesh materials for breathability and support.
  • Enhanced lateral stability with a higher midsole topline.
  • PU support on the tip for added durability where needed.
